I converted a flv file to avi. Then I stored it on my usb flash memory stick that I then plug into my dvd player, that can play avi files.

However, it didn't play the video portion of it, just audio. It also came up with a message saying codec not supported.

Does this mean there are different types of avi files? I thought avi was a defined format and so any avi player could play it!

avi is a 'container' for many different codecs, can your dvd player play divx or xvid files?

you could convert it to them
